Select Sam's Club Stores (link for reference only) [store locator] have for their Members: 85" Samsung QN85 Series Neo QLED 4K Ultra HD Smart TV (QN85QN85CDFXZA) on sale for In-Store Purchase Only at $991.91. Availability and pricing will vary depending on location.

Product Features (link):
  • Resolution: 3840x2160 (4K Ultra HD)
  • Refresh Rate: 120Hz
  • Smart TV Platform: Tizen
  • 100% Color Volume w/ Quantum Dot
  • HDR10+ support
  • Built-In Speakers: Yes (4.2.2 channel)
  • Surround Sound Supported: Dolby Atmos
  • Speaker Power Output: 70W
  • 802.11ac WiFi
  • Ports:
    • 4x HDMI
    • 2x USB
    • 1x RF
    • 1x Optical (Digital audio output)
    • 1x Ethernet
  • Sam's Club Member Bonuses:
    • 5-Year Allstate Protection Plan included
    • Streaming Credit : Your choice of Hulu, Paramount+, or Xbox Game Pass subscription (up to a $65 value)

Story time!

I showed up today to pick up the order early because I wasn't sure if it would still be in stock during my pickup time tomorrow. One other guy I had never seen before was there with a flatbed cart. There were a couple of TVs left. We helped each other load our carts with our separate TVs. It is gigantic!

I checked out before the other guy and went out to my car. I opened the back hatch and realized it would not fit unless I unbox the TV. As I was doing so, a couple of different people walked by me and asked if I needed help. I wasn't sure yet if I needed help, and so I told them that I could probably take care of it.

Then, the other guy from the store that I had helped load his flatbed walked past me and said "Hey, if you want, I can load yours into my truck, follow you to your house, and drop it off. " Wow! I had no idea someone would be so kind. I told him that I lived farther away than he probably would want to go. He said he lived in a town that was only about 10 or 15 minutes from where I lived. And he said he could help me.

I said okay, we loaded both of the TVs into his truck, he followed me to my house, we unloaded mine, and then he went on his way. I was so surprised how kind he was, and how nice it was for him to take time to do this.

People are really genuinely kind sometimes.

For skeptics who might say I was too trustworthy: I had his phone number and license plate. And I just got a good vibe from him. I hope he realized what a kind act that was. It makes me want to pay it forward.

It's the panel type used for the display. Off angle viewing isn't the best, but you'll want to be sitting directly in front of the panel. I have the QN95C 85" with VA panel, and my wife and I sit directly in front of it. No issues whatsoever. VA panels have superior contrast as well.

If I'm not going OLED, I'd rather have a VA panel over an ADS panel. Lastly, the 2023 QN90C utilizes an ADS panel.
